Email headers are the branded strip that appears at the very top of every email you send. They give recipients an instant visual cue about who the message is from—using your logo, brand colors, and navigation links to make your emails look professional and immediately recognizable. You can view and manage all your saved headers from the Email > Headers screen.
Access the Headers list screen to view, edit, and create new branded headers for your email campaigns.
To get started, click the **New Header** button in the top-right corner. A dialog will appear with a single field. Give your header a descriptive internal name—like 'Primary Brand Header'—so your team can easily find it when building campaigns.
The header editor uses the same intuitive visual builder you use for pages, streamlined specifically for the inbox. Instead of the full website toolkit, it provides a curated set of email-safe blocks designed to render flawlessly across all email clients. Drop in an image block for your logo, add text blocks for navigation links, and customize your branding elements with confidence. Behind the scenes, your layout is automatically compiled into responsive, bulletproof code.
Your email header is the first thing recipients see. Use the visual builder to design a reusable, branded strip featuring your logo and navigation links. Once perfected, attach it to any email campaign with a single click in your design settings.
Keep your workspace organized by giving each email header a descriptive internal name. The settings dialog also gives you quick access to the header's unique ID and tracks exactly when it was created or last updated.
Once your header is ready, attaching it to an email is simple. Open your email in the editor, click the Settings icon, and navigate to the Design tab. Choose your new header from the dropdown menu to instantly apply your branding.
Email clients are notorious for stripping out custom CSS. To ensure maximum compatibility across different inboxes, Giant Context compiles your headers into MJML behind the scenes. For the best results, stick to simple, clean designs that render reliably everywhere.
Open your email in the editor and click the Settings icon in the toolbar. Navigate to the Design tab, then select 'None' from the Header dropdown menu to remove it.
Because headers are attached from the outside, any changes you make to a global header will automatically apply to every email that uses it. Update it once, and your entire campaign stays perfectly on brand.
